Temporary Dehumidification System - PNSY Description Portsmouth Naval Shipyard seeks to identify sources capable of providing the leasing of temporary dehumidifcation equipment for the Portmouth Naval Shipyard located in Kittery, ME in accordance with the attached statement of work. Interested vendors responses due 11:59 PM ET on Tuesday, October 22, 2024. SCOPE: Portsmouth Naval Shipyard (PNSY) is seeking to lease a Desiccant Climate Controlled Unit (DCCU) system to provide dry and tempered process air for conditioning various spaces used for industrial applications. The system must include multiple DCCU-s, a chiller, chilled water pump, chilled water hose manifolds, hose assemblies as well as the associated onboard controls to operate both the chilled water system and DCCU-s. The intent of the chiller, pump, hose assemblies, manifolds and ancillary components is to establish a temporary chilled water system which serves all of the DCCU-s pre-cooling and post-cooling coils. All equipment conveying air to and from the industrial space must be pre-wired with remote E-Stop capability in order to provide a means to secure airflow in the event of an emergency response. Each DCCU and Chiller must be frame skid mounted and meet the lifting handling requirements as defined in the specification. This Sources Sought announcement is published for Market Research Purposes ONLY. *At a later date, an actual solicitation may be posted to the Government Point of Entry, GPE, at SAM.gov with an official Solicitation number, RFQ Form, and Performance Work Statement. The market research information collected resulting from this Sources Sought Notice will be used to help the Government to identify qualified sources capable of accomplishing the required work outlined in the attached Statement of Work under NAICS Code 532490.
